Belinda Baloney Changes Her Mind is a story about a young girl trying to figure out what she wants to be when she grows up. She has lots of big dreams, but can’t seem to pick just one. Maybe she’ll be an engineer, the President, or a knitter of coats. She could be a firefighter, a farmer, or a sailor of boats!


When Belinda starts to get worried that she doesn’t know how to pick just one job, her brother helps her learn an important lesson. She doesn’t need to answer the 'What do you want to be when you grow up?' question just yet. Even if she does, her answer is probably going to change along the way and that’s more than okay! Growing and learning can take a lifetime, and Belinda Baloney can change her mind!


This 'when I grow up' rhyming book filled with fun illustrations is perfect for preschool, kindergarten, and elementary school-aged children.
